Output ef303561591d9da5e29027bbe54e0c8f6125fb88ac571238b7f5b0663ecde862:20

value
592234
script pubkey
OP_0 OP_PUSHBYTES_20 7050ca156cbc544a9ed8fbe1495bdb7760a48305
address
bc1qwpgv59tvh32y48kcl0s5jk7mwas2fqc94u0qcc
transaction
ef303561591d9da5e29027bbe54e0c8f6125fb88ac571238b7f5b0663ecde862